Absinthe
£2.25More information
Absinthe, a wormwood and star aniseed flavoured aperitif, was the drink of choice among artists and writers in the late19th century.
It inspired poets and appeared in works by Pablo Picasso and Vincent Van Gogh.
It was drunk by the scandalous playwright Oscar Wilde, the eccentric Toulouse-Lautrec, the poets Charles Baudelaire and Edgar Allen Poe, and the famous 20th century author Ernest Hemingway, just to mention a few. -
After Hours
£2.25More information
After Hours is a social drink with the delicate flavour of chocolate mint. Serve well cooled in a shot glass or use as a mixer.
Instructions: Pour the contents of this bottle and 250 grams (9 oz) of granulated sugar into a 75 cl (US 25 fl oz) bottle. Fill 3/4 full with vodka and shake until the sugar has dissolved.
Top up the bottle and shake until the contents have fully blended. -
